Transaction 28e56cac65791245aae56186ba61ca27184a559c8231750506bf53e4a583cc35
2 Input
3 Outputs
- 28e56cac65791245aae56186ba61ca27184a559c8231750506bf53e4a583cc35:0
- 28e56cac65791245aae56186ba61ca27184a559c8231750506bf53e4a583cc35:1
- 28e56cac65791245aae56186ba61ca27184a559c8231750506bf53e4a583cc35:2
value 20000000
address 1AbcuEa7W6ZRUhWiEFPCutAEqT1wcawnvu
value 3468900
address 1D6RRrrz3BC7ViXGN6gMQD69YvGPxqysua
value 180811
address 1DFTCU3NWy775ZaUiHHMw514TZAjgyYgSL